This set of 8 high-impact ABS plastic corner clamps includes 4 clamps at 3" and 4" sizes, designed to hold wood pieces at a perfect 90° angle. Lightweight yet durable, they are ideal for woodworking projects like cabinets, frames, drawers, and custom jigs, enabling fast, precise, and reliable clamping for professional-quality results.

Mods needed
I really liked the idea of being able to square up a box with these. I bought universal fence clamps to go with them. I was hoping they would work well together, but what I really needed was corners with holes for the clamps. So, the mod I made was to drill holes in them. Now, they work perfectly. I suppose I should have been using standard ratcheting clamps, but the small corners would simply be too small for those clamps. The mod does work though.

Pretty accurate and useful
Within a few tenths of a degree of 90 so should work well for hobbyist work. If you're seeking absolute precision for a more demanding application than typical woodworking then you may wish to look elsewhere.
